Output 34d5fbeb9205ea783fdac795e3126a75de1a8d3e6e6eb166243e524dcc6aa376:25

value
8481354
script pubkey
OP_0 OP_PUSHBYTES_20 20756314b250dec3b830b49f4b5aaef2afee8dbf
address
ltc1qyp6kx99j2r0v8wpskj05kk4w72h7ardla9eufx
transaction
34d5fbeb9205ea783fdac795e3126a75de1a8d3e6e6eb166243e524dcc6aa376
spent
true